What is the average price of a house in Medway?

The average price for a house in Medway is £438k, costing on average £690 per sqft.

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£288k for a two-bedroom, £364k for a three-bedroom, £536k for a four-bedroom, and £773k for a five-bedroom.

What share of houses in Medway feature gardens and parking?

In Medway, 95% of houses have a garden and 93% include parking.

What is the breakdown of property types in Medway?

The housing mix in Medway is 30% detached, 33% semi-detached, 27% terraced, and 10% other.

What is the most expensive area in Medway to buy a home?

The most expensive area to buy a house in Medway is ME18, where the average property is £755k. The second and third most expensive areas are ME19 with an average price of £667k and ME17 with an average price of £544k .

What is the cheapest area in Medway to buy a home?

The cheapest area to buy a house in Medway is ME11, where the average property is £275k. The second and third cheapest areas are ME7 with an average price of £322k and ME12 with an average price of £327k .

What is the average price of a flat in Medway?

The average price for a flat in Medway is £194k, costing on average £351 per sqft.

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£154k for a one-bedroom, £211k for a two-bedroom, £318k for a three-bedroom, and £475k for a four-bedroom.

What share of flats in Medway feature balconies and parking?

In Medway, 26% of flats have a balcony and 93% include parking.

What is the breakdown of lease types in Medway?

The leasing mix in Medway is 98% leasehold and 2% freehold.

What is the most expensive area in Medway to buy a flat?

The most expensive area to buy a flat in Medway is ME20, where the average property is £296k. The second and third most expensive areas are ME19 with an average price of £267k and ME6 with an average price of £253k .

What is the cheapest area in Medway to buy a flat?

The cheapest area to buy a flat in Medway is ME5, where the average property is £66k. The second and third cheapest areas are ME3 with an average price of £128k and ME12 with an average price of £142k .
